Research on the Dynamic Evolution of Residual Stress in Thermal
Processing of Diesel Engine Blocks Based on FEM
Abstract
The residual stress generated during the thermal processing process such
as casting and heat treatment is one of the key reasons for the
irreversible deformation of the diesel engine block. However, the
previous research only conducted research and analysis unilaterally from
the residual stress generated by casting or the effect of annealing heat
treatment on the residual stress of castings, and the analysis results
were quite different from the actual ones. Therefore, a comprehensive
research method is proposed to consider the whole dynamic evolution
process of castings from casting residual stress to heat treatment
stress elimination. Through PROCAST numerical simulation of the casting
process of diesel engine blocks, the simulation results of casting
residual stress are introduced into the ABAQUS, and then the model of
block casting with casting residual stress is simulated by annealing
heat treatment. To realize the dynamic evolution of residual stress from
casting to heat treatment.
